I have called this principle, by which each slight variation, if useful, is preserved, by the term Natural Selection.
- Charles Darwin, The Origin of Species



Natural selection- in lame mans terms, is when a species (say a grass hopper) needs to survive. say these grasshoppers are green. when the grass is green these grasshoppers cannot be found by birds, thus they are plump from thriving so long. any yellow grass hoppers will die in the green grass because a bird will see it.

say the grass dies, the birds will see the green ones and not the yellow ones. because the yellow ones will blend in. the birds will eat the green ones and leave the yellow ones to live

say a green and a yellow grass hopper have 2 babies. one is green one is yellow. the grass gets greener and the yellow mommy dies. the yellow baby grass hopper will also die. this eliminates the yellow gene from the gene pool. the gene pool is all the genes in an area. so in your yard the genes are yellow or green. when all the yellow ones die out only green is left. if the grass turns yellow and all the green grass hoppers die, this species of grass hoppers becomes extinct.

say your yard does not supply enough food for these grasshoppers, the smallest ones will die and the strongest or most adapted will live. so the ones that can get food faster and easier will live, passing this trait down to their offspring. this will cause the gene pool to become specifically adapted to your yard. if any of these grasshoppers ended up somewhere else with different surroundings ,they would most likely die.

this is just a basic look into natural selection.
